Output 851738a45adf1c42ec586a2c61326ba04e4590bf4eefcf2199a661c3eb5cb89b:1

value
63910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b58f706338e4d2f9cb3d11e9d835260e8e1504b OP_EQUAL
address
32j1w3dajLvukkA2zBM9G7eAe2BwzPpwCz
transaction
851738a45adf1c42ec586a2c61326ba04e4590bf4eefcf2199a661c3eb5cb89b
spent
true